Half the Marlowe gateway nodes have per-message deflate enabled and half don't, because the setting was flipped manually during the Bramblewood latency investigation and never reconciled. Compression cuts bandwidth roughly 60% on chatty dashboard clients but adds measurable CPU and memory per connection, so the tradeoff was intentional — just never codified. Future maintainers: do not hand-edit nodes again. The agreed fleet-wide baseline we are converging on is recorded below.

service settings:
PRAWYN_PIN=9848
PRAWYN_METRICS_HOST=metrics.prawyn.lumicworks.corp
PRAWYN_LOG_LEVEL=warn
PRAWYN_TENANT=pelius

## Changelog — Ticktrace 1.9

### Renamed: DRIFT_API_TOKEN
During the cron drift investigation we found plugins confusing this variable with the metrics token, so it has been renamed to indicate it authorizes drift-report uploads specifically. Plugin authors must read the new name from 1.9 onward; the old name is ignored without warning. Sample env files in the SDK are updated. In your deployment env file, the drift-report upload secret is set on the next line.

env line for fawef-taguf: VAULT_KEY13=a9695905a9a90

// WEBHOOK_MAX_RETRIES
// Delivery retries for outbound webhooks in the Ferndale Relay service.
// Retries use exponential backoff with jitter; after this limit, the event
// is parked in the dead-letter queue and never replayed automatically.
// Security note: retried payloads are re-signed per attempt, so a captured
// signature cannot be replayed against a later delivery. The signing keyset
// is pinned to the build identified immediately below.

pipeline stamp: htk9_ce63042d9

Subject: Possible Acquisition — Confidential. Dear Board, following preliminary discussions, Varrow Holdings has expressed openness to a full sale of its Quillane division. Initial diligence suggests a reasonable multiple given their recurring revenue base, though integration costs in the Dellmere facility warrant scrutiny. Advisors have been briefed under NDA. A short confidential summary of our related business plans follows below.

confidential, bahap-bajog: Zorethix Works is in early talks to buy Kelethox Foods for about $30.7 million. The Ralvan launch date is September 19, and nothing goes to the press before then.